It is what precedes it.<\/p>\n\n  <h2>What &#8220;having premises&#8221; does not prove<\/h2>\n\n  <p>A commercial lease signed for a campus in Lyon or Paris is, in property law terms, a solid legal act. For the French educational framework, it is nothing. It does not prove institutional capacity. It does not prove governance. It does not prove assignable academic responsibility. It does not prove the readability of your project under the regulatory references.<\/p>\n\n  <p>More precisely: a lease can become an <strong>institutional debt<\/strong>. It does when the signature precedes the architecture, when the walls constrain choices that should have remained open, when rental pressure forces academic decisions that a prior institutional reading would have sequenced differently.<\/p>\n\n  <p>Three consequences observed when the lease precedes the reading:<\/p>\n\n  <p>First, the choice of academic regime is constrained by the space rather than by the mission. An institution that should have begun with a small-scale executive format finds itself locked into an undergraduate dimensioning because the building imposes it.<\/p>\n\n  <p>Second, the calendar becomes a tyrant. Rent runs. The authorities, themselves, take the time they take. The financial pressure pushes the institution to communicate before being readable, to recruit before having authorisation, to open before being defensible.<\/p>\n\n  <p>Third, the image projected by the address sometimes contradicts the mission. A technical school established in the Paris eighth arrondissement, a public governance institution backed onto a peripheral shopping centre: these territorial dissonances are readings the authorities make silently, but which weigh on the reception of the dossier.<\/p>\n\n  <h2>The three early readings the authorities perform<\/h2>\n\n  <p>Before formal examination, three readings take place. They are structurally constitutive.<\/p>\n\n  <h3>Reading 1: the reading of the public signal<\/h3>\n\n  <p>Every public communication, press, social media, institutional website, professional conference, is read by the French system. The question the authorities silently ask is not &#8220;what have you announced&#8221; but &#8220;can you hold what you have announced under regulatory scrutiny&#8221;.<\/p>\n\n  <p>An institution that announces a Master&#8217;s degree before its RNCP positioning is built has created a gap between its communication and its structure. That gap is read. It becomes a fragility point that the formal dossier will have to address, even if it is not explicitly mentioned by the authorities.<\/p>\n\n  <h3>Reading 2: the reading of assignable responsibility<\/h3>\n\n  <p>The French framework does not receive an abstract academic responsibility. It receives the designation of a named individual, whose qualification, effective presence, and capacity to answer to the authorities are identifiable. This is not an administrative formality. It is a condition of structural readability.<\/p>\n\n  <p>The institution that has not yet identified and formally engaged this holder, or that delegates this responsibility to an abstract entity rather than to a named individual, is not readable. This holds whatever the quality of its academic project, its capital, or its international brand.<\/p>\n\n  <h3>Reading 3: the reading of territorial coherence<\/h3>\n\n  <p>France reads the address. Not only the city. The neighbourhood. The nature of the building. Its proximity to other educational or economic actors. Its correspondence with the stated mission.<\/p>\n\n  <p>A governance school five minutes&#8217; walk from an existing institution of the same kind can be read as complementary or as competing, depending on how the institutional architecture is presented. A technology-oriented institution far from the relevant industrial basins will be read as isolated from the economic fabric it claims to serve.<\/p>\n\n  <p>These readings are not verdicts. They are angles of reception. They shape the authorities&#8217; willingness to receive the subsequent dossier favourably.<\/p>\n\n  <p class=\"pull\">The French authority does not decide only on what you present to it.
